The book has also been adapted into a made-for-television movie titled “Pursuit” in 1972, directed by Crichton himself.īinary is a must read as it is a focused bio-terrorism thriller where ambition meets technology. The story touches on technology dangers and the extremes people go for power. The antagonist plans to expose thousands of attendees at a convention to a deadly nerve agent, only to favor his own political interests. The novel narrates the efforts put in By the protagonist John Graves, a government agent at preventing a schemed disaster. Disclosureīinary, another novel written under the pseudonym John Lange.
